766dc4a5e8f0a70985c1dc6fe781c17c8587602f: Bug 1505897 - Initialize GeckoSystemStateListener in child process r=agi
James Willcox <snorp@snorp.net> - Fri, 16 Nov 2018 14:34:48 +0000 - rev 503217
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1505897 - Initialize GeckoSystemStateListener in child process r=agi Differential Revision: https://phabricator.services.mozilla.com/D11517
624e45ad97c89acc0b916c3c7c53b95cdb1f5014: Bug 1507192 - Give slot 0 of Stream callback functions a name. r=tcampbell
Jason Orendorff <jorendorff@mozilla.com> - Fri, 16 Nov 2018 13:31:51 +0000 - rev 503216
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507192 - Give slot 0 of Stream callback functions a name.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D11901
e3e05897de25a3b5d4d8d41ac5c20463c62153e0: Bug 1507184 - API tweaks to new Unwrap templates. r=tcampbell
Jason Orendorff <jorendorff@mozilla.com> - Fri, 16 Nov 2018 13:31:17 +0000 - rev 503215
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507184 - API tweaks to new Unwrap templates.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D11896
79c527fa7f0f2c2ed645f59a30f2bc105e2868d4: Bug 1503406 - Fix cross-compartment bug in ReadableStreamTee_Pull. r=tcampbell
Jason Orendorff <jorendorff@mozilla.com> - Fri, 16 Nov 2018 13:30:47 +0000 - rev 503214
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1503406 - Fix cross-compartment bug in ReadableStreamTee_Pull. r=tcampbell Differential Revision: https://phabricator.services.mozilla.com/D11697
7154eb3601f3b89ef5b8e559c9f2bae57f6d59f3: Bug 1507314 - Baldr: correctly propagate shell flags to nested testig process on Windows (r=bbouvier)
Luke Wagner <luke@mozilla.com> - Fri, 16 Nov 2018 12:03:51 -0600 - rev 503213
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507314 - Baldr: correctly propagate shell flags to nested testig process on Windows (r=bbouvier)
9dbfa9bdcd0b393a1a396513c8e08e42e4a3da8a: Merge mozilla-central to inbound. a=merge CLOSED TREE
Gurzau Raul <rgurzau@mozilla.com> - Fri, 16 Nov 2018 19:55:39 +0200 - rev 503212
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Merge mozilla-central to inbound. a=merge CLOSED TREE
a7812eefff9559ee40e9f0a8e6c812ea9d36f06d: Bug 1505632 - Baldr: correctly propagate AbortError from consume stream body operation (r=lth,baku,Ms2ger)
Luke Wagner <luke@mozilla.com> - Fri, 16 Nov 2018 10:32:20 -0600 - rev 503211
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1505632 - Baldr: correctly propagate AbortError from consume stream body operation (r=lth,baku,Ms2ger)
91b2fc1a6529b25ff73b3c2a14d7add667057155: Bug 1506138 - fix minidump_callback.h for aarch64 windows; r=ted.mielczarek
Nathan Froyd <froydnj@mozilla.com> - Fri, 16 Nov 2018 10:49:13 -0500 - rev 503210
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1506138 - fix minidump_callback.h for aarch64 windows; r=ted.mielczarek
95c0c22616c161aff925f1ddc124f0da40561905: Bug 1504222 - Notify the client when devtools goes from replaying to recording. r=dwalsh
Jason Laster <jlaster@mozilla.com> - Sun, 11 Nov 2018 12:42:33 -0500 - rev 503209
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1504222 - Notify the client when devtools goes from replaying to recording. r=dwalsh Tags: Bug #: 1504222 Differential Revision: https://phabricator.services.mozilla.com/D11593
71ba7cfafa54a4b458abd2b1962a0bee4011173b: Backed out changeset d459920f97a5 (bug 1476604) for causing Bug 1507781 a=backout
Gurzau Raul <rgurzau@mozilla.com> - Fri, 16 Nov 2018 19:32:13 +0200 - rev 503208
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Backed out changeset d459920f97a5 (bug 1476604) for causing Bug 1507781 a=backout
d6ac0dc85306b753c1d1d5f3084f73f0d1286b86: Merge inbound to mozilla-central. a=merge
Gurzau Raul <rgurzau@mozilla.com> - Fri, 16 Nov 2018 19:08:39 +0200 - rev 503207
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Merge inbound to mozilla-central. a=merge
6c28ad7f98a7629f5a1b2f123aaad66f1f6233f0: Bug 1501482. r=tnikkel
Andrew Osmond <aosmond@mozilla.com> - Tue, 13 Nov 2018 09:41:58 -0500 - rev 503206
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1501482. r=tnikkel Differential Revision: https://phabricator.services.mozilla.com/D11897
a43822d30dcf77d0734df7da40b39f882ab852a8: Bug 1506807 - Set object-position-svg-002e.html to fail on Linux opt WebRender because it permafails. a=test-only DONTBUILD
Sebastian Hengst <archaeopteryx@coole-files.de> - Fri, 16 Nov 2018 15:55:31 +0200 - rev 503205
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1506807 - Set object-position-svg-002e.html to fail on Linux opt WebRender because it permafails. a=test-only DONTBUILD
ae143b5f65fb4a80538e765541de7f999c909233: Bug 1506762 - Store wr::WebRenderPipelineInfo directly in AsyncImagePipelineManager::PipelineUpdates r=mattwoodrow
sotaro <sotaro.ikeda.g@gmail.com> - Fri, 16 Nov 2018 22:01:01 +0900 - rev 503204
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1506762 - Store wr::WebRenderPipelineInfo directly in AsyncImagePipelineManager::PipelineUpdates r=mattwoodrow
98b78581ff763823e5eb20b0b559181e12bea5ea: Bug 1507730: Generate a temporary for negative power-of-two constants in mul64 on 32 bits platforms; r=lth
Benjamin Bouvier <benj@benj.me> - Fri, 16 Nov 2018 11:44:36 +0100 - rev 503203
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507730: Generate a temporary for negative power-of-two constants in mul64 on 32 bits platforms; r=lth In the code generator function, we assume we have a temp if a known constant is a non-negative power of two. But lowering only checked for power of twos independently of their sign, so this was incorrect. This patch syncs them up on both ARM32 and x86.
15a5a4be9a35e39d05a0995238ecc6d3a2163ec4: Bug 1507100: Don't generate a global section in wasm::TextToBinary if there are no globals; r=lth
Benjamin Bouvier <benj@benj.me> - Tue, 23 Oct 2018 14:22:02 +0200 - rev 503202
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507100: Don't generate a global section in wasm::TextToBinary if there are no globals; r=lth Then, we generate a minimal wasm module when translating the string `(module)` to the wasm binary. Differential Revision: https://phabricator.services.mozilla.com/D11865
7069cf49cb20869b3705a94047b8f763001a4223: Bug 1507100: Disable wasm GC when Cranelift is enabled; r=lth
Benjamin Bouvier <benj@benj.me> - Wed, 14 Nov 2018 11:53:24 +0100 - rev 503201
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507100: Disable wasm GC when Cranelift is enabled; r=lth This caused an early initialization failure in the main() function of the JS shell, which also caused a full leak warning, and a hard test failure (exit code was non-zero). This patches silently disables GC when Cranelift is enabled instead, which translates into soft test failures.
fc0bc3b27660a2dcf0be70ad2e2dabd400f307aa: Bug 1507572 - correctly implement unaligned stores of i64 sub-fields. r=bbouvier
Lars T Hansen <lhansen@mozilla.com> - Fri, 16 Nov 2018 09:39:26 +0100 - rev 503200
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507572 - correctly implement unaligned stores of i64 sub-fields. r=bbouvier Fixes Rabaldr by adding code to the ARM assembler to deal with unaligned 16- and 32-bit stores from a 64-bit datum. Fixes Baldr by dispatching on the value type (as we do everywhere else), not the access type, and then relying on the just-fixed assembler to do the right thing.
f970d9b9b00c57bef40a51639390a0b2d4c1502e: Bug 1507572 - Generalize alignments for memory ops testing. r=bbouvier
Lars T Hansen <lhansen@mozilla.com> - Fri, 16 Nov 2018 10:47:36 +0100 - rev 503199
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507572 - Generalize alignments for memory ops testing. r=bbouvier These test cases already had some infrastructure for parameterizing over alignment, it just wasn't being used. Once enabled it stubles across the ARM bugs quickly.
2ea6c6932f6e45bb6f472dd8d5271d53a22788ac: Bug 1507403 - Add more tests for clone before key evaluation; r=asuth
Jan Varga <jan.varga@gmail.com> - Fri, 16 Nov 2018 11:05:37 +0100 - rev 503198
Push 10290 by ffxbld-merge at Mon, 03 Dec 2018 16:23:23 +0000
Bug 1507403 - Add more tests for clone before key evaluation; r=asuth
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 tip